What Is the YS3060 Grating Spectrophotometer?
The YS3060 Grating Spectrophotometer is a professional color measurement instrument designed to analyze the spectral characteristics of samples and provide quantitative color data.
A grating spectrophotometer separates light into different spectral components so that the instrument can analyze how a material interacts with light. This allows us to obtain detailed spectral information instead of relying only on subjective visual assessment.
The YS3060 is intended for laboratory color analysis, color matching, product inspection, and color delivery. Its combination of advanced optical geometry, multiple measurement modes, and extensive data storage makes it suitable for organizations that need a flexible color measurement platform.

SCI and SCE Measurement in One Instrument
The YS3060 supports both SCI (Specular Component Included) and SCE (Specular Component Excluded) measurements.
These two approaches provide different perspectives when evaluating the color and appearance of materials.
With SCI, the specular component is included in the measurement. This can be useful when the objective is to evaluate the intrinsic color of a sample with reduced influence from surface gloss.
With SCE, the specular component is excluded, producing measurement conditions that can be more closely associated with how surface appearance is perceived.
By combining SCI and SCE in one system, the YS3060 provides greater flexibility for professional color analysis.
UV Included and UV Excluded Measurement
One of the important capabilities highlighted for the YS3060 is its support for UV Included and UV Excluded measurement.
Ultraviolet radiation can influence the appearance of materials containing fluorescent components. When optical brighteners or fluorescent substances are present, UV conditions can affect the measured and perceived color.
The YS3060 incorporates a combined LED light source that includes UV capability, allowing users to work with different measurement conditions.
This can be particularly useful when analyzing materials where fluorescence or optical brightening needs to be considered as part of the color measurement process.
